SHEROZ CAR WASH

Sheroz Car Wash is located in karachi, Pakistan.
Address: plot no.97, 13-d/2 Block-Gulshan-e-iqbal, karachi
Country: Pakistan
City: Karachi
Find Business in:
Like · Comment · Share · Posted by DirectoryForest · Aug 15, 2014